What is tahini used for?
Tahini is commonly used in hummus, salad dressings, sauces, and as a spread. It adds a rich, nutty flavor to various dishes.
Is tahini gluten-free?
Yes, tahini is naturally gluten-free, making it a great option for those with gluten sensitivities or celiac disease.
How should tahini be stored?
Tahini should be stored in a cool, dark place, like a pantry. Once opened, it can be refrigerated to maintain freshness.
Can you make tahini at home?
Yes, you can make tahini at home by blending toasted sesame seeds with a little oil until smooth. Itβs easy and fresh!
